Functional purpose and operating principle
Main task automatic transmission cooling radiator is to maintain the operating temperature of the transmission fluid in the range from 80 to 95 degrees Celsius. When this threshold is exceeded, the oil loses its viscosity properties, which leads to a decrease in hydraulic pressure and slipping of the friction discs. B Nissan Pathfinder R51 the system is designed so that hot oil from the box enters the heat exchanger, where it transfers heat to the engine coolant or the environment.
There are two main types of designs used on this model: a built-in heat exchanger in the engine radiator and a separate external radiator. The built-in version is more compact, but has a drawback - when the engine overheats, the transmission also suffers. An optional external radiator provides more efficient heat dissipation, especially at low speeds. The correct choice of radiator type is critical for operation in difficult conditions.
The efficiency of heat transfer depends on many factors, including the condition of the honeycombs themselves, the cleanliness of the coolant and the tightness of the pipes. Any deviation from the norm leads to overheating. If you notice that gear shifting has become rough or there are jerks, you should immediately check the oil temperature in the box.
Main causes of failure and signs of malfunction
The most common cause of radiator failure is Nissan Pathfinder R51 is corrosion of aluminum honeycombs or destruction of plastic tanks from vibration and temperature changes. Over time, the metal loses strength and microcracks appear in it. Through these defects, transmission fluid leaks, which reduces the oil level in the system and causes oil starvation of the pump.
Another serious problem is contamination of internal channels. Friction wear products, metal shavings and carbon deposits settle on the walls of the radiator, creating a heat-insulating layer. This dramatically reduces the efficiency of heat removal. As a result, the box overheats even if the device appears to be in good working order. It is also common for the outer honeycomb to become clogged with dirt, lint or insects.
- 🔥 Overheat: The temperature indicator on the dashboard lights up, or there is a smell of burnt oil coming from under the hood.
- 💧 Leaks: Red fluid stains remain on the asphalt under the car, and the level in the automatic transmission reservoir is constantly dropping.
- ⚙️ Loss of traction: The car accelerates poorly, gears are engaged with a delay or jerks.
It is important to understand that even a small leak can lead to complete failure of the box within a few kilometers. If you notice a drop in oil level, stop immediately and check the condition of the system. Low oil level - This is the fastest way to kill a torque converter.
⚠️ Attention: If you find red smudges under the car, under no circumstances continue driving until the problem is eliminated. Operating the gearbox without enough oil will cause it to seize instantly.
Selecting an original radiator and high-quality analogues
When choosing a replacement for Nissan Pathfinder R51 owners are often faced with a dilemma: to take the original or a high-quality analogue. Original radiator from Nissan guarantees a perfect match to dimensions and materials, but its cost is often overpriced. In addition, original spare parts may not be available in regional warehouses.
High-quality analogues from manufacturers such as Nissens, Denso or Behr, often offer the best value for money. These companies use modern materials that are resistant to corrosion and vibration. However, when purchasing an analogue, you must carefully check the article number and overall dimensions, since different years of manufacture Pathfinder Various modifications of radiators can be installed.
- ✅ Original: Perfect fit, quality guarantee, high price, risk of counterfeiting.
- 🛠️ Premium analogue: Good quality, affordable price, wide selection available.
- ⚠️ Budget analogue: Low price, risk of rapid failure, thin cells.
Particular attention should be paid to the material of the tanks. Plastic becomes brittle over time and may crack during installation or use. Metal tanks are more reliable, but more expensive. When purchasing, be sure to check the markings on the radiator housing to ensure compatibility with your V6 or V8 engine version.

Automatic transmission radiator replacement procedure
Replacing an automatic transmission cooling radiator is a task of average complexity that can be done independently if you have a garage and a lift. The process begins with draining the transmission fluid. Unscrew the drain plug on the transmission pan and drain the oil into a clean container. Be careful, the oil may be very hot if the engine has been running recently.
Next you need to remove the old radiator. Disconnect the pipes supplying oil to and from the radiator. On some models, this may require a special tool to remove the clamps. Unscrew the mounting bolts holding the radiator to the body or frame and carefully remove it, being careful not to damage surrounding parts.
☑️ Preparing to replace the radiator
Installing a new radiator is done in the reverse order. Be sure to replace the O-rings on the pipes, as the old ones may not provide a tight seal. After installation, fill with fresh transmission fluid to the correct level and start the engine. Check the system for leaks while the engine is running and gears are changed.
⚠️ Attention: After installing a new radiator, be sure to perform the system bleeding procedure. Turn on the engine, change all gears in turn, holding each gear for 2-3 seconds, then check the oil level again.

Flushing and servicing the cooling system
If the radiator has no visible damage, but the box still overheats, the problem may be that the internal channels are dirty. In this case, professional cleaning will help. Remove the radiator and wash it under high pressure using special chemical solvents that remove carbon deposits and oil breakdown products.
It is also worth checking the condition of the external cooling circuit. The engine radiator honeycombs may be clogged with dirt, which impairs heat transfer. Use compressed air or a soft brush to clean the exterior surfaces. Do not use harsh chemicals that may damage the thin aluminum plates.
- 🧼 Chemical wash: Removes internal deposits and restores throughput.
- 💨 External cleaning: Improves heat dissipation and increases system efficiency.
- 🔍 Diagnostics: Checking for leaks after washing is mandatory.
Regular maintenance of the automatic transmission cooling system extends the life of the transmission by thousands of kilometers. Change the transmission fluid according to the regulations, without waiting for signs of wear to appear. Clean fluid provides better lubrication and more efficient heat transfer.
To flush the radiator, use only special automatic transmission fluids; do not use acidic or alkaline compounds that can destroy aluminum and seals.

Overheating prevention and operating recommendations
To prevent problems with automatic transmission overheating, Nissan Pathfinder R51 It is recommended to install an additional oil temperature sensor in the box. The standard indicator often shows the temperature only at critical values, which prevents the problem from being suspected at an early stage. An external sensor will allow you to monitor the temperature in real time.
When operating in difficult conditions (off-road, towing a trailer), it is necessary to install an external automatic transmission cooling radiator with a fan. This will ensure forced cooling even when the car is stopped. It is also worth reducing transmission fluid change intervals and using only fluids recommended by the manufacturer (for example, Nissan Matic J or Matic S).
If you are planning a long trip over difficult terrain, check the condition of the entire cooling system before leaving. Make sure that the radiator fan is working correctly and that the coolant level in the expansion tank is normal. Any malfunction in the engine cooling system can also affect the operation of the gearbox.
⚠️ Attention: When driving off-road at low speeds, natural air circulation is insufficient. In such conditions, the presence of an additional automatic transmission cooling fan is critically important, otherwise overheating will occur after 15-20 minutes of active driving.
Frequently asked questions (FAQ)
Is it possible to repair an old automatic transmission radiator rather than replace it?
In some cases, it is possible to solder aluminum honeycombs or replace plastic tanks, but this is a temporary measure. Repairs often do not restore channel capacity, and the risk of repeated failure remains high. Replacing with a new element is more reliable and durable.
How often should I change the transmission fluid on my Pathfinder R51?
The manufacturer recommends changing the oil every 60,000 km. However, when operating in difficult conditions (city, off-road, towing), the interval should be reduced to 40,000 km. Regular replacement prevents contamination of the radiator and wear of the clutches.
What happens if you ignore automatic transmission overheating?
Prolonged overheating leads to degradation of oil properties, destruction of friction discs, scuffing on the pump shaft and overheating of the torque converter. As a result, a major overhaul or complete replacement of the gearbox is required, which is very expensive.
Can I install an external radiator on any version of the Pathfinder R51?
Yes, installing an external radiator is possible on almost any modification. For this purpose, special fastening kits and pipe extensions are used. This is one of the most effective ways to protect an automatic transmission from overheating.
How to check that a new radiator is working correctly?
After installing and starting the engine, check the temperature at the radiator outlet and at the inlet to the box. The temperature difference should be 10-15 degrees. Also visually check for leaks and the operation of the fan (if there is one).
